Peer reviewedKoch, Laura Coffin; Li, Xiaoming – Journal of Mathematical Behavior, 1996
Investigates the differences between students' and instructors' perceptions of similarities among basic computation-related rational number skills. Results indicate that college students in developmental mathematics do see some relationships among rational number computation skills, although not necessarily the ones seen by instructors. (AIM)

Osler, Thomas J.; Hassen, Abdulkadir; Chandrupatla, Tirupathi R. – College Mathematics Journal, 2007
The sum of the divisors of a positive integer is one of the most interesting concepts in multiplicative number theory, while the number of ways of expressing a number as a sum is a primary topic in additive number theory. In this article, we describe some of the surprising connections between and similarities of these two concepts.
